Taxonomic revision of <i>Geotrichum</i> and <i>Magnusiomyces</i> , with the descriptions of five new <i>Geotrichum</i> species from China

The arthroconidial yeast-like species currently classified in the asexual genera <i>Geotrichum</i> and <i>Saprochaete</i> and the sexual genera <i>Dipodascus</i>, <i>Galactomyces</i> and <i>Magnusiomyces</i> are frequently associated with dairy and cosmetics production, fruit rot and human infection. However, the taxonomic system of these fungi has not been updated to accommodate the new nomenclature code adopting the "one fungus, one name" principle. Here, we performed phylogenetic analyses of these yeast-like species based on the sequences of the internal transcribed spacer (ITS) region and the D1/D2 domain of the large subunit of the rRNA gene. Two monophyletic groups were recognised from these species. One group contained <i>Dipodascus</i>, <i>Galactomyces</i>, and <i>Geotrichum</i> species and the other <i>Magnusiomyces</i> and <i>Saprochaete</i> species. We thus assigned the species in each group into one genus and selected the genus name <i>Geotrichum</i> for the first group and <i>Magnusiomyces</i> for the second one based on the principle of priority of publication. Five new <i>Geotrichum</i> species were identified from arthroconidial yeast strains recently isolated from various sources in China. The new species are described as <i>Ge. dehoogii</i> sp. nov., <i>Ge. fujianense</i> sp. nov., <i>Ge. maricola</i> sp. nov., <i>Ge. smithiae</i> sp. nov., and <i>Ge. sinensis</i> sp. nov.
